Abstract

We apply Christ’s method of refinements to the ell ^p-improving problem for discrete averages {mathcal {A}}_N along polynomial curves in {mathbb {Z}}^d. Combined with certain elementary estimates for the number of solutions to certain special systems of diophantine equations, we obtain some restricted weak-type p rightarrow p' estimates for the averages {mathcal {A}}_N in the subcritical regime. The dependence on N of the constants here obtained is sharp, except maybe for an epsilon -loss.
